Some number x is added to 7 for every number in the sequence. So, the second number is 7+x, the third number is 7+2x... So the tenth number is 7+9x = 34. Solve for x, x=3. The fifth number is 7+4x, which is 7+(4*3), which is 19

One half of a fifth is equivalent to one-tenth. To find one half of a number, you divide the number by 2. In this case, a fifth is equal to 1/5, so dividing 1/5 by 2 gives you 1/10, which is one-tenth.
